Chaman: Main highway remains closed for the fourth day in protest

The main Chaman highway at Kojak has been closed for the fourth day in protest, causing long queues of vehicles and difficulties to passengers.

The protest comes after the abduction of Asad Khan, cousin of Awami National Party leader and Member of Provincial Assembly (MPA), Asghar Achakzai. Asad Khan, the provincial spokesman for the Awami National Party, was reportedly kidnapped from Chaman, last Friday.

All parties from Balochistan have taken stand that the wheel jam strike has been started as the provincial press secretary of ANP has not been recovered yet.

Due to the closure of Quetta-Chaman highway, Afghan transit, NATO supplies and all types of transport have been completely cut off.

Quetta-Chaman highway is the main route connecting Balochistan to Afghanistan.

Passengers have been banned from traveling on the Quetta-Chaman highway.

All parties said that the Quetta-Chaman International Highway will remain closed until Asad Khan is recovered.
